
Description
Large lot at just under 3 acres with tons of privacy and set back off main roadways. Land is entirely open, bring the horses or exotic farm animals and enjoy all that northeastern Union County can offer. Site has completed full septic permitting for a 4 Bedroom septic system. New Survey, driveway connection to Hwy 218 is graded and installed with a shared concrete drive to just beyond the NCDOT right of way and gravel drive completed over 1000' back to the lot. Public water is on Hwy 218 and water line has been constructed along the driveway leading back to the lot. Modest covenants and restrictions that allow for Barndos or off-frame Modular. Ancillary ag, horticultural or equestrian structures are allowed. No HOA Dues. Drive times to Oakboro, Locust, Mint Hill, and Indian Trail range from 12-30 minutes. Dollar General is located 1.3 miles east of the site and 1.5 mile drive to New Salem School. A quick little 8.3 mile drive to the new Charlotte Pipe and Foundry in Oakboro.
